Six Mile is looking great, a little mud in the usual places. Some of the high trails could actually use some moisture.

I found some bear tracks today, first time I've seen them there. They're by the stream crossing once you cross Middlebush (coming from the soccer field side). Take a look if your out that way, I marked the one print with an arrow in the dirt.

There has been some trail damage caused by dirt bikes, I finally caught one of the little buggers and gave him an earful of my thoughts. We met head to head on a section of narrow singletrack and he had no place to go. I don't think he liked me very much..:eek:

I may join you guys as well. Anyone help me out with directions to the parking lot.

Route 27 in north Brunswick/Franklin Park.

South bound side. North of Finnegan's lane and south of Cousins lane.

Look for the Jersey Knights Sign. Get there ready to roll away at 8:30am.

There are some good directions on the MTBR trail locator.
